The Lax formulation of the hyper-Hermiticity condition in four dimensions is
used to derive a potential that generalises Plebanski's second heavenly
equation for hyper-Kahler 4-manifolds. A class of examples of hyper-Hermitian
metrics which depend on two arbitrary functions of two complex variables is
given. The twistor theory of four-dimensional hyper-Hermitian manifolds is
formulated as a combination of the Nonlinear Graviton Construction with the
Ward transform for anti-self-dual Maxwell fields.
